Discussing death and afterlife planning may be a taboo subject to some, but there will definitely come a time where one will have to speak with someone about it.to promote the new drama Till the End, local veteran actress-host Kym Ng said that her family is open to talk about funeral plans.

"My mother is very generous and daring to talk about it, she would not avoid it and I am able to discuss it with her," said Kym. "I want to be lowkey and leave quietly, and I don't want anything elaborate. I don't mind being buried in a garden. I don't want my ashes to be placed in an urn and for people to come and 'collect' me," she said then.
